通达信选股公式简介:
极阴转阳选股公式通过一系列条件判断,包括价格的相对位置、波动幅度、均线关系以及成交量等多个维度,来筛选出可能的极阴买入点。代码中涉及了多个自定义变量(如VAR1至VAR11),每个变量都代表了特定的市场条件或技术指标。
公式效果图:
指标源码及源码注释:
VAR1:=C=LLV(C,60);{判断当前收盘价是否为60天内最低价}
VAR2:= REF(SUM((C-REF(C,1))/C*100,3)< -10,1) OR REF(SUM((C-REF(C,1))/C*100,4)< -10,1) OR REF(SUM((C-REF(C,1))/C*100,5)< -15,1);{判断过去3、4、5天内的累计跌幅是否超过-10%或-15%}
VARA1:=CLOSE/MA(CLOSE,30)*100< 75;{计算收盘价与30日移动平均价的比例是否低于75%}
VARA2:=CLOSE/MA(CLOSE,50)*100< 78;{计算收盘价与50日移动平均价的比例是否低于78%}
VARA3:=HIGH>LOW*1.053;{判断最高价是否超过最低价的105.3%}
VARA4:=VARA3 AND COUNT(VARA3,5)>2;{判断过去5天内,最高价超过最低价105.3%的天数是否超过2天}
VARA5:=VARA4 AND (VARA1 OR VARA2);{结合VARA4与VARA1、VARA2的条件}
VARA6:=DMA(EMA(CLOSE,5),SUM(VOL,8)/2.8/CAPITAL);{计算动态均线}
VARA7:=(CLOSE-VARA6)/VARA6*100;{计算收盘价与动态均线的百分比差}
VAR8:=REF(VARA7,1)< -34 AND VARA7>REF(VARA7,1) AND REF(VARA7,1)< REF(VARA7,2) AND VARA7-REF(VARA7,1)>1.76 OR VARA5;{结合VARA7的变化与VARA5的条件}
VAR9:=(C-SMA(C,13,1))/SMA(C,13,1)*(-100);{计算收盘价与13日简单移动平均价的负百分比差}
VAR10:=REF(VAR9,1)>13 AND REF(VAR9,1)/VAR9>1.23 AND C/REF(C,1)>1.03;{结合VAR9的变化率与收盘价的变化}
VAR11:=IF(VAR10 AND REF(C,1)< COST(1),1,0);{如果满足VAR10且昨日收盘价低于成本价,则为1,否则为0}
极阴买入:FILTER(CROSS(0.5,VAR1),10) AND VAR2;{如果VAR1上穿0.5且满足VAR2条件,则为买入信号}